JOSEPH C. HUTCHESON, Chief Judge.

These are petitions to review Tax Court decisions in Causes Nos. 3455 and 20082, determining deficiencies in income tax, declared value excess profits, and excess profits, taxes for the fiscal years ended September 30, 1941, through 1944, and assessing a penalty. By order of the court they have been consolidated for the purpose of the record and their submission here.
